Laura was inspired to become involved in performing arts as a child by passionate and motivational teachers – both in school and out – and she is delighted to be able to now share her passion with the next generation of young people. Laura trained professionally at Laban Centre London (now Trinity Laban) where she had the opportunity to work with choreographers including Mark Baldwin and Mark Murphy, as well as, performing in the UK and Spain in Purcell's The Fairy Queen.
